I use a Boss RC-600 loop pedal and a Boss ME-80 effects pedal to create original music and arrangements of cover songs. As an improvising musician, I blend elements from a diverse scope of genres, weaving between pop, fiddling, and modern jazz. My live looping arrangements and compositions have led to solo performances around the Nashville area to other parts of the country including San Francisco, California and Dallas, Texas.

My name is Caleb Yang and I’m a cellist based in Nashville, TN.

Since 2015, I have experimented with incorporating live looping in my arrangements, compositions, performances, and teaching. Over the years, I’ve become convinced live looping is an essential tool for every 21st century string player to explore technique development, creative practice ideas, arranging, composition, improvisation, participation in new musical genres, and groove.

I am passionate about helping string players use live looping for deepening musicianship and enjoying creative music making.

I’m also interested in the usage of live looping in private studio and group teaching settings. After completing my cello performance degree at UCLA studying under Latin Grammy winning cellist Antonio Lysy, I had the unique opportunity to study as a graduate student of commercial music with Tracy Silverman at Belmont University, where I got my Masters of Music degree. Tracy Silverman, known for his groundbreaking work with the 6-string electric violin, is named one of 100 distinguished alumni by The Juilliard School. With the mentorship from Silverman and my jazz improvisation teacher Dr. Bruce Dudley, I presented a lecture recital and published my master’s thesis titled “Creative Practice for Classical String Players with Live Looping”.

“Creative Practice for Classical String Players with Live Looping”

ABSTRACT

In recent years, string pedagogy discussions have highlighted the greater need for creative practice as classical string players. Since the second half of the nineteenth century, string methods have shifted towards a limited scope of improvisatory techniques, parallelling the decline of improvisation in Western classical music performance practices. This thesis explores live looping as a practice tool to facilitate learning concepts and help string players develop musicianship skills including improvisation, participate in non-classical genres, and explore their creative voices. Examining the results of string educators that incorporate live looping into their own teaching reveals the tool’s effectiveness in bridging curricula standards with opportunities for avenues of creativity and endless experimentation. Ultimately, live looping can help string players learn a concept more deeply, employing scaffolding techniques to practice abstract models and thus relying less on any specific example such as learning from sheet music. This encourages a broader musical foundation enabling classical string players to feel more equipped in areas beyond their comfort zones and participate in and enjoy a wider range of musically fulfilling experiences.
